BBYR Achieve
返回信息流
这是一条镜像帖。来源:北邮人论坛 / office-tool / #12344同步于 2008/9/28
该镜像源已超过 30 天没有更新,可能在源站已被删除。
OfficeTool机器人发帖

[合集] 问个excel的问题

mara
2008/9/28镜像同步1 回复
☆─────────────────────────────────────☆ smiles (微笑之葩葩) 于 (Tue Sep 23 15:54:43 2008) 提到: 在一个excel里 我有两个表sheet1和sheet2。sheet2里只有一列设为列A(列A中的数据是sheet1中列B的数据的一个子集),大概50条左右的数据,sheet1有7列,几万条数据。 现在我要做的是,若sheet1中B列包含sheet2中任意一条数据,则把这条数据提取出来。我在网上查了,别人建议用vlookup,但是我用的可能不对,反正结果是错的。希望懂的人指点指点,或者具体说说vlookup怎么用的也行。先谢谢啦~[em17] ☆─────────────────────────────────────☆ xiongQQ (隐形的黑手) 于 (Tue Sep 23 15:57:51 2008) 提到: 就是用vlookup○丫 仔细看看帮助吧 上面写得挺清楚了 【 在 smiles (微笑之葩葩) 的大作中提到: 】 : 在一个excel里 我有两个表sheet1和sheet2。sheet2里只有一列设为列A(列A中的数据是sheet1中列B的数据的一个子集),大概50条左右的数据,sheet1有7列,几万条数据。 : 现在我要做的是,若sheet1中B列包含sheet2中任意一条数据,则把这条数据提取出来。我在网上查了,别人建议用vlookup,但是我用的可能不对,反正结果是错的。希望懂的人指点指点,或者具体说说vlookup怎么用的也行。先谢谢啦~[em17] ☆─────────────────────────────────────☆ smiles (微笑之葩葩) 于 (Tue Sep 23 16:00:25 2008) 提到: 【 在 xiongQQ 的大作中提到: 】 : 就是用vlookup○丫 : 仔细看看帮助吧 : 上面写得挺清楚了 可是我看了公式,还是用得不对,结果返回总是错误。你能不能给个具体的例子? ☆─────────────────────────────────────☆ xiongQQ (隐形的黑手) 于 (Tue Sep 23 16:05:59 2008) 提到: http://blog.tom.com/yekong_007/article/306.html 这个例子比较合适 【 在 smiles (微笑之葩葩) 的大作中提到: 】 : 可是我看了公式,还是用得不对,结果返回总是错误。你能不能给个具体的例子? ☆─────────────────────────────────────☆ smiles (微笑之葩葩) 于 (Tue Sep 23 16:11:39 2008) 提到: 【 在 xiongQQ 的大作中提到: 】 : http://blog.tom.com/yekong_007/article/306.html : 这个例子比较合适 那个。。 但是我的数据表是这样的,sheet2中某一条数据a,在sheet1中可能有很多条a,但是这些重复的数据我也要一一提取出来,好像vlookup不行耶? ☆─────────────────────────────────────☆ xiongQQ (隐形的黑手) 于 (Tue Sep 23 16:13:18 2008) 提到: 恩 需要查找的数据是唯一的 你这种的情况可以用条件筛选来做 【 在 smiles (微笑之葩葩) 的大作中提到: 】 : 那个。。 但是我的数据表是这样的,sheet2中某一条数据a,在sheet1中可能有很多条a,但是这些重复的数据我也要一一提取出来,好像vlookup不行耶? ☆─────────────────────────────────────☆ smiles (微笑之葩葩) 于 (Tue Sep 23 16:16:20 2008) 提到: 【 在 xiongQQ 的大作中提到: 】 : 恩 : 需要查找的数据是唯一的 : 你这种的情况可以用条件筛选来做 其实之前一直是用筛选做的,但是每个表要条件筛选50次,然后还有很多表,所以才想寻求比较简单的方法,不过还是谢谢你啦~ ☆─────────────────────────────────────☆ xiongQQ (隐形的黑手) 于 (Tue Sep 23 16:29:11 2008) 提到: 那就VBA上之 大概就是下面这些代码 不过需要自己改改才能用 2007年10月23日 星期二 15:07Sub macro3() Dim i As Byte, temp As String, sh As String For i = 1 To Sheets.Count temp = temp & i & "." & vbTab & Sheets(i).Name & vbCrLf Next sh = InputBox("Please select a sheet from the following sheets:" & vbCrLf & temp, "Info", Int(Rnd * Sheets.Count + 1)) shtSelect = Sheets(Val(sh)).Name Set sht = Sheets.Add '自动增加新的表格 sht.Name = InputBox("please inpunt a new name:") '给新的表格添加标题 Set myRange = Application.InputBox(prompt:="Select a cell", Type:=8) '选取条件区域 Sheets(shtSelect).Activate Sheets(shtSelect).UsedRange.AdvancedFilter Action:=xlFilterCopy, CriteriaRange:= _ myRange, CopyToRange:=sht.Range("A1"), Unique:=False End Sub 【 在 smiles (微笑之葩葩) 的大作中提到: 】 : 其实之前一直是用筛选做的,但是每个表要条件筛选50次,然后还有很多表,所以才想寻求比较简单的方法,不过还是谢谢你啦~ ☆─────────────────────────────────────☆ lxin (〖冰雪猪联盟〗|玲珑冰雪猪|盟主) 于 (Tue Sep 23 16:30:02 2008) 提到: 这qmd的第一行是啥? 【 在 xiongQQ (隐形的黑手) 的大作中提到: 】 : 那就VBA上之 : 大概就是下面这些代码 : 不过需要自己改改才能用 : ................... ☆─────────────────────────────────────☆ xiongQQ (隐形的黑手) 于 (Tue Sep 23 16:39:08 2008) 提到: /╲⺗灬╱\ /╲⺗灬╱\ 我能想到最浪漫的事 .。 ︵︵ .: ︳ ▕ ︳ ︳ . ·. 。 .· ( ) ヾ ╭╮╭╮ " ╭╮╭╮゛ ·.就是和你一起慢慢变老 .∵╲╱ ゛ ゞ * *ゞ .:︵︵ . 。 ¨.· . ╰┐ ┌"╰┐ ┌╯ ( ) itsokbaby ╭/ \╮ / \╮ ╲╱:·. ╰────╯"────╯ I. 不要问BBS能为你做什么,而要问你为BBS做了什么 II. 大牛努力回答牛问题,菜青虫努力回答菜问题。大家都要努力回答别人的问题 III. BBS是靠良性循环存在的,只想获取不愿奉献的人不是网络人:) IV. 一个好的站点是靠大家的努力建成的,懒于回答别人的人也不会得到别人的回答 V. 注意:本签名档拷贝粘帖而来,非本ID原创 一个7行 一个5行 ( ̄。 ̄)~~~ 【 在 lxin (〖冰雪猪联盟〗|玲珑冰雪猪|盟主) 的大作中提到: 】 : 这qmd的第一行是啥? ☆─────────────────────────────────────☆ smiles (微笑之葩葩) 于 (Tue Sep 23 18:10:05 2008) 提到: 【 在 xiongQQ 的大作中提到: 】 : 那就VBA上之 : 大概就是下面这些代码 : 不过需要自己改改才能用 最后用java解决了... 不得不说 程序真的是很强大的哇~ o(∩_∩)o... 谢谢你那么热心~ ☆─────────────────────────────────────☆ xiongQQ (隐形的黑手) 于 (Tue Sep 23 18:34:23 2008) 提到: 呵呵 解决了就好 欢迎常来玩○合 【 在 smiles (微笑之葩葩) 的大作中提到: 】 : 最后用java解决了... 不得不说 程序真的是很强大的哇~ o(∩_∩)o... 谢谢你那么热心~ ☆─────────────────────────────────────☆ mara (lpbuhuai) 于 (Tue Sep 23 18:49:53 2008) 提到: 其实我也很想常来教别人呀,可是对这方面的不是特别熟悉。。。 【 在 xiongQQ (隐形的黑手) 的大作中提到: 】 : 呵呵 : 解决了就好 : 欢迎常来玩○合 : ................... ☆─────────────────────────────────────☆ xiongQQ (隐形的黑手) 于 (Tue Sep 23 18:51:51 2008) 提到: 呵呵 没事○圭 有问题一起讨论就好了 VBA这块我也是才学的 【 在 mara (lpbuhuai) 的大作中提到: 】 : 其实我也很想常来教别人呀,可是对这方面的不是特别熟悉。。。 ☆─────────────────────────────────────☆ lxin (〖冰雪猪联盟〗|玲珑冰雪猪|盟主) 于 (Tue Sep 23 19:00:45 2008) 提到: Orz…… 【 在 xiongQQ (隐形的黑手) 的大作中提到: 】 : /╲⺗灬╱\ /╲⺗灬╱\ : 我能想到最浪漫的事 .。 ︵︵ .: ︳ ▕ ︳ ︳ : . ·. 。 .· ( ) ヾ ╭╮╭╮ " ╭╮╭╮゛ : ................... ☆─────────────────────────────────────☆ xiongQQ (隐形的黑手) 于 (Tue Sep 23 19:10:51 2008) 提到: 所以其他QMD都没问题 So 懒得管了 【 在 lxin (〖冰雪猪联盟〗|玲珑冰雪猪|盟主) 的大作中提到: 】 : Orz…… ☆─────────────────────────────────────☆ xiongQQ (隐形的黑手) 于 (Tue Sep 23 23:00:37 2008) 提到: 加油○圭 呵呵 其实我一直很喜欢这个QMD I. 不要问BBS能为你做什么,而要问你为BBS做了什么 II. 大牛努力回答牛问题,菜青虫努力回答菜问题。大家都要努力回答别人的问题 III. BBS是靠良性循环存在的,只想获取不愿奉献的人不是网络人:) IV. 一个好的站点是靠大家的努力建成的,懒于回答别人的人也不会得到别人的回答 V. 注意:本签名档拷贝粘帖而来,非本ID原创 【 在 mara (lpbuhuai) 的大作中提到: 】 : 呵呵,好的。虽然,恩,水平,不过会好好学的,呵呵 : 呵呵 : 没事○圭 : ................... ☆─────────────────────────────────────☆ mara (lpbuhuai) 于 (Tue Sep 23 23:06:33 2008) 提到: 看出来了,室友说你一直都喜欢在这个版上,对这个版很有感情的说。。。 【 在 xiongQQ (隐形的黑手) 的大作中提到: 】 加油○圭 呵呵 其实我一直很喜欢这个QMD I. 不要问BBS能为你做什么,而要问你为BBS做了什么 II. 大牛努力回答牛问题,菜青虫努力回答菜问题。大家都要努力回答别人的问题 III. BBS是靠良性循环存在的,只想获取不愿奉献的人不是网络人:) IV. 一个好的站点是靠大家的努力建成的,懒于回答别人的人也不会得到别人的回答 V. 注意:本签名档拷贝粘帖而来,非本ID原创 【 在 mara (lpbuhuai) 的大作中提到: 】 : 呵呵,好的。虽然,恩,水平,不过会好好学的,呵呵 : 呵呵 : 没事○圭 : ................... ☆─────────────────────────────────────☆ xiongQQ (隐形的黑手) 于 (Tue Sep 23 23:08:37 2008) 提到: 呵呵 你看看精华区就知道了○圭 我是这的第二任版主 【 在 mara (lpbuhuai) 的大作中提到: 】 : 看出来了,室友说你一直都喜欢在这个版上,对这个版很有感情的说。。。 : 加油○圭 : 呵呵 : ................... ☆─────────────────────────────────────☆ mara (lpbuhuai) 于 (Tue Sep 23 23:14:23 2008) 提到: 哦,这样。好吧,向前前前。。。任版主问好哈 【 在 xiongQQ (隐形的黑手) 的大作中提到: 】 : 呵呵 : 你看看精华区就知道了○圭 : 我是这的第二任版主 : ................... ☆─────────────────────────────────────☆ police (我其实想换个名。。。。) 于 (Tue Sep 23 23:18:06 2008) 提到: 赞qmd 【 在 xiongQQ (隐形的黑手) 的大作中提到: 】 : 加油○圭 : 呵呵 : 其实我一直很喜欢这个QMD : ...................
订阅后,新回复会通过你的通知中心匿名送达。
1 条回复
Darius机器人#1 · 2008/10/6
上vba很强大,不过只需vlookup就可以解决单列的搜索,数据透视表就可以解决多列的搜索。